Angelina Jolie will soon be making her comeback on the big screen this year. Helmed by director Taylor Sheridan, the film will see the actress take on the role of an expert firefighter trained to parachute into a blaze.
Set in Montana's wilderness, Angelina will be fighting killers and wildfires as she tries to rescue a teen. The film's trailer which dropped a few days ago showed visually stunning scenes of the actress running through a blaze, holding her breath underwater while the forest continues to burn and being tactical.
However, the action packed scenes were not the hardest thing for Angelina to pull off. In an interview with Entertainment Weekly, Jolie revealed that one of the most difficult scenes to pull off were with her teen.
